587652-62-8,587-66-6,6109-00-8,58768-16-4,61423-69-6,58769-33-8 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 587652-62-8,587-66-6,6109-00-8,58768-16-4,61423-69-6,58769-33-8 and related compounds.
587652-62-8 58769-33-8 58768-16-4 61423-69-6 6109-00-8 587-66-6